Estimation of the Randomness of Heart Rhythm Using Fractal Characteristics

Abdullaev Namik Tahir, Ibrahimova Irada Javad
The article discusses the characteristics of the fractality of heart rate variability represented by a time series. An algorithm for calculating the Hurst exponent is presented, which allows one to evaluate the degree of chaotization of the signal in question. The capabilities of various multifractal analysis programs are shown, which require the use of different mathematical models.

Effect of Rate Constants in TF Regulated Gene Expression

Enakshi Guru, Sanghamitra Chatterjee
Simple mathematical model of gene expression has been studied thoroughly in this paper. We assume that protein synthesis and protein decay are deterministic in nature whereas transition from active to inactive state is totally stochastic. The probability distribution function of transcript number is calculated and evidence of binary and graded response has been observed for different reaction rates.
